Cattle Famine Threatened in Country
Situation Acute
in United States
PORTLAND, Ore., May 10 Latest!
reports received from leading cattle
producing centers of tne country Indl-!
cate a serious condition ao far as sup-
pile are concerned. With heavy ex
porlntiona of beef to Europe and with
a fast decreasing supply of cattle in;
thia country, the outlook Is seemingly ,
for u famine In meats such aa thH,
country has never witnessed.
This has called forth comment from
consuming and butchering Interests to i
the effect thnt the government should
place an emburgo against further for
eign shipments until the American
supplies become heavier.
Such agitation is likely to become
stronger as the price of beef on the
hoof advances ami the price to the
consumer moves higher. The recent
advance in the price of baliy beef at
Nurth Portland to the highest price
on record here for open market tran
sactions Indicate quite clearly that
there is a dearth of real good quality,
and that killers are v:elng with one
! another to secure these supplies. This
i means not only extreme prices for top
quality stuff, but also means that all
beef prrices will he advanced in pro
portion In the Pacific northwest the de
crease In cattle holdings has been less
marked than In other sections of the
Country, but the withdrawal of sup
plies for eastern .shipment has made
the shortage here even more acute
than elsewhere.
LIVERPOOL HIGHER
EVEN WITH STOCKS
ON A HEAVY SCALE
POHTUNtl. Ore.. May 10 Whllo
very heavy receipts or whent arc
shown at Liverpool and purchases to
go forward are also heavy for the im
mediate future, there was a slightb
hetter feeling in the cash wheat trade
there during the day. Broomhall
quoted cash whent unchanged to 2d
higher for the day.
Chicago market showed little change
during the early trading, the market
not making the serious decline expect
ed as a result of Monday's government
report showing less crop damage than
expected. The trade Is much Inclined
to take this report with a grain of salt,
especially as it given Oregon a very
poor crop outlook, when It has one
of the best in the country, while It
gives the middle west a better show
ing when all connected with the trade
hnve direct Information which would
Indicate a poor showing.

WEEK'S TRADING IN
THE CATTLE MARKET
PORTLAND, Ore, May 10 Th
market opened rather brisk, although
the receipts were light. One ship
ment of pulp fed steerR sold at $9 15,
this lielnsc the top price. Bulk grain
fed stock sold at $8.85 to $9.00. No
change in prices of cows, heifers or
I alia, receipts being very light. There
Wits a slight decrease in calf receipts
this week, although the prices were
unchanged.
HORS.
A fair run of hogs was received. The
bulk sold at prices ranging from $9 to
$9.16, The top prices reached beim;
$9.20 and $9 25. Market closing
strong.
sheep.
The receipts are showing a marke.i
increase. Spring lambs ure bringing
$10 to $10.50. No change in prices of
wethers and ewea. This class of stock
is still In great demand.

Commission I'orni Defeated.
DENVER. May 10 The
commission form of government
which has been in force for
three years, was decisively over-
thrown and Roliert W. Speer
4 was elected mayor for the third
time. The election restored
the councilmanlc form by a
heavy vote.
